Rambert and (LA)HORDE
I went to see ‘We Should Have Never Walked On The Moon’ at the Southbank Centre, a co-production between Rambert and (LA)HORDE, they took over the entire Southbank Centre, with performances in each hall, outside on the riverside terrace and different floors in the Royal Festival Hall and Queen Elizabeth Hall. Combing elements of dance, video, a full-sized remote control car with hydraulics to help it bounce, this was an amazing experience!

The Felt Sound System
I did a set for the Felt Sound System on their amazing set up in the middle of a park in Tottenham; I played a raga music set, with a couple of cheeky tracks thrown in at the end, but it was amazing to be sharing this music in a non-typical environment for this music style. The people loved it and it sounded immense on a phat sound system.

The Invocation Players with Tommy Khosla and Vishnu Vijayan
I went to the Invocation Players with Tommy Khosla and Vishnu Viyjan perform the Ananda Shankar album in the round at the Mildmay Club. The place was full, with a really engaged and attentive audience; the performance was was full of energy and a fitting tribute to the Ananda Shankar experience!
